Address 0 PPC

PVLSdGaa6cBefL3VNXnK1ZGduuxoodX8sR

Confirmed

Total Received50.876001 PPC
Total Sent50.876001 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PVLSdGaa6cBefL3VNXnK1ZGduuxoodX8sR50.876001 PPC
Fee: 0.01 PPC
671518 Confirmations50.866001 PPC
Fee: 0.01 PPC
671554 Confirmations151.627715 PPC